Exploring the Installation Process From Start to Finish
Preparing the base layer correctly ensures the liquid resin adheres properly to your concrete. Thus, we grind away old sealers and open up the pores of the substrate.
Following that crucial step, we patch any cracks or pits using industrial-grade epoxy mortar. This careful preparation guarantees a smooth result that looks stunning in any residential space.
Applying the Base Coat and Decorative Chips
Once the prep work finishes, our technicians roll out a thick pigmented primer layer. This base bonds tightly and sets the stage for the decorative vinyl flakes.
Throwing colored flakes across the wet resin adds texture and hides minor imperfections. Because of this method, your floors gain slip resistance and remarkable visual appeal.
Sealing the Deal With a Clear Topcoat
Applying a transparent top layer locks everything in place for lifelong protection. Therefore, heavy impacts and harsh chemical spills bounce off the cured surface harmlessly.
This final step gives you a mirror-like shine that elevates the general aesthetic of your workspace. Plus, sweeping away dust takes mere seconds when you have such a seamless finish.

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Moran, Kansas?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.

How long until I can park on it?
Foot traffic in 24 hours, full vehicle traffic at 72 hours. Hot-tire pickup is not a concern with professional-grade resins.
